Solace Day 6.

Unusually we were aiming to be back at the marina a day early and with time to have the pump out, diesel topped up and the water tank filled.

A lovely day so we stopped for lunch more or less where we moored the first night.  One of the joys of being on the canals for me is the wildlife is so used to boats that they more or less ignore you.  Once a young heron sat on a bay-wash at a lock while we operated the lock and 4 teenagers walked past.

While we were moored this Greylag ( Anser anser ) decided it was bath time.  In some of my shots you could barely tell there was a bird there, head and shoulders under water and the rest of the body hidden by splashes.
